Background
•Many Iron ores and Iron deposits exists in the Kiruna area.
•A number of them can be found in a fairly limited area just
south of the town, at Rakkurijoki and Rakkurijärvi.
•The area has been investigated by geophysical surveys,
diamond drilling etc. since 1898 by severeal entities.
•The latest exploration efforts resultet in the application for a
mining concession for the Discovery zone by Anglo American &
Rio Tinto.
•The present study aims at assessing the total iron resources
within the area, as well as giving an idea of its potential.
Technique
•Based on 121 diamond drillholes (not all assayed).
•Wireframed on a 20% Fe model cut-off.
•Wireframes extended down to a maximum of 50-100m below
deepest intercept except where otherwise indicated by holes in
adjacent sections.
•Drillhole intercepts created by cutting holes with wireframe
and then checked for consistency.
•Assay sections composited to 5m.
•Block size 20*20*5 m, using sub-blocks of 5*5*1.25m to best fit
geometries.
Technique (cont.)
•A variography study was attempted but aborted due to the
fairly low data density.
•All interpolation was done using ID squared.
•Search ellipses individually modelled for each area.
•Block models not cut against bedrock-overburden interface!

Results
Inferred Area Zone Grade Tonnage
resources (see map) [% Fe] [Mton]
Rakkurijärvi South 101 27.2 5.5
Rakkurijärvi Discovery 401 25.5 7.1
Rakkurijärvi Discovery 402 26.5 3.0
Rakkurijärvi Discovery 403 28.6 2.9
Rakkurijoki 501 34.5 48.6
Rakkurijoki 502 36.1 20.6
Total 33.2 87.6
Exploration Area Zone Grade Tonnage
targets (see map) [% Fe] [Mton]
Rakkurijärvi East 201 25.0 19.1
Rakkurijärvi North 301 35.9 10.3
Total 25-36 25-35
